Gallofree Yards, Inc.
Gallofree Yards, Inc. was a shipwright that manufactured the GR-45[1] and the GR-75 medium transports.[2] It eventually went bankrupt and was taken over by the Empire-backed Kuat Drive Yards, who incorporated aspects of Gallofree's characteristic freighter design into its Vakbeor-class cargo frigate.[5] One of the last ships it made was the casino cruiser Morenia.[6]
